Iron oxide pigments are among the most widely used colorants in the world, offering durability, safety, and vibrant hues across a vast range of industrial and consumer applications. Derived from natural minerals or synthesized through chemical processes, these pigments deliver consistent, non-toxic coloring properties — especially in red, yellow, brown, and black shades.

What makes iron oxide pigments particularly valuable is their stability. They are resistant to light, chemicals, and weather conditions, making them ideal for long-lasting applications. In the construction industry, for example, these pigments are commonly used in concrete, bricks, tiles, and paving stones to provide a rich, uniform color that doesn’t fade over time. Whether it’s earthy tones in landscape architecture or vibrant reds in decorative concrete, iron oxide pigments help designers achieve both aesthetics and resilience.

In paints and coatings, iron oxide pigments serve as essential components in protective and decorative finishes. Their UV resistance and chemical inertness ensure that exterior coatings maintain their appearance and shield surfaces from environmental degradation. Automotive coatings, industrial paints, and metal primers all benefit from the anti-corrosive properties of these pigments.

The cosmetics and personal care industry also relies on iron oxide pigments, particularly for natural and organic formulations. Approved by global safety agencies, these pigments are found in products like foundations, eyeshadows, and lipsticks, where they offer both vibrant color and skin compatibility. Their non-toxic, hypoallergenic nature makes them ideal for sensitive skin.

Synthetic iron oxide pigments are manufactured using controlled processes to ensure purity, consistency, and customizable shades. Compared to their natural counterparts, these pigments offer tighter color tolerances, making them preferable in industries requiring precision, such as plastics, ceramics, and electronics.

Environmental sustainability is becoming increasingly important in the pigment industry. Many manufacturers now focus on eco-friendly production processes, including the recycling of industrial waste materials to synthesize pigments. The shift toward low-VOC (volatile organic compound) paints and sustainable construction further increases the relevance of iron oxide pigments in the green economy.

The global iron oxide pigment market is projected to grow steadily, driven by booming construction activity, rising urbanization, and increasing demand for environmentally safe colorants. Asia-Pacific leads consumption, especially in construction and coatings, while Europe and North America emphasize regulatory compliance and product innovation.
